Obama Presidential Center in Jackson Park to Open in June, Former President Says

The $800 million center will host a museum, library, and athletic facilities on 20 acres to foster community dialogue and leadership development, Obama said.

  • On Monday, former President Barack Obama announced the Obama Presidential Center will open in June next year in Jackson Park, Chicago , during a Q&A at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art, Arkansas.
  • After being announced in 2015, the Obama Presidential Center only began construction in 2021 and faced lawsuits and federal reviews that a judge dismissed in 2022.
  • The $800 million project will feature a 225-foot museum tower and span 20 acres with an auditorium, Chicago Public Library branch, gardens, parkland and athletic facility.
  • Nearby South Side residents fear rising taxes, rents and displacement, while the Chicago City Council passed a housing ordinance this year to ease those impacts after controversy over Jackson Park.
  • The Obama Foundation says the center will serve as a network for young leaders aged 25, emphasizing leadership development and civic education, and providing a public space for dialogue.
